Discovering Herculaneum’s Better-Preserved Ruins

Private day tour: Pompei and Herculenium. - Discovering Herculaneum’s Better-Preserved Ruins

After exploring Pompeii, the tour proceeds to Herculaneum, which offers a more intimate look at Roman life before the eruption. Preserved beneath volcanic debris, the structures and artifacts are in remarkably good condition, revealing detailed frescoes, wooden structures, and private homes.

With 2 hours available, visitors can walk through narrow streets, admire well-preserved mosaics, and observe how the ancient town was covered quickly by volcanic material. The site’s preservation quality provides more detailed insights into daily living, making it a favorite for those interested in archaeological authenticity.
